Delegation of Sint Maarten Parliament Participates in Opening of IPKO 2025 in The Hague

SINT MAARTEN/THE HAGUE - On September 26, 2025, the delegation of the Parliament of Sint Maarten participated in the opening day of meetings of the Interparliamentary Kingdom Consultations (IPKO) in The Hague. The Presidium of the IPKO first met to discuss and officially establish the program for this IPKO. SMYC Publishes Notice of Race and Opens Registration for the 20th Edition of the Budget Marine Optimist Championship 2025

SINT MAARTEN (SIMPSON BAY) - The Sint Maarten Yacht Club (SMYC) is proud to announce the publication of the Notice of Race (NOR) and the official opening of registration for the landmark 20th edition of the Budget Marine Optimist Championship, taking place November 27 - 30 in the waters of Simpson Bay. Over the past two decades, the Optimist Championship has grown into one of the premier youth sailing events in the Caribbean, consistently attracting talented young sailors from across the region and beyond, with a record of 44 Optimists, from 8 different islands competing in last year's edition. KPSM Thanks Public for Assistance in Identifying Shooting Suspects

SINT MAARTEN (GREAT BAY) - The Police Force of Sint Maarten (KPSM) would like to express its sincere gratitude to the general public of Sint Maarten and surrounding islands for their invaluable assistance in the ongoing investigation into a shooting incident that took place in the Middle Region area on April 30, 2025. Following the circulation of a press release containing images of two suspects believed to be involved in this incident, KPSM has successfully received the information needed to identify both individuals depicted in the press release. The cooperation proved essential in advancing this investigation. KPSM is grateful for the numerous tips and information provided by citizens who responded to our call for assistance.
